Evidence is required to be collected that demonstrates a candidate’s competency in this unit. Evidence must be relevant to the roles within this sector’s work operations and satisfy all of the requirements of the performance criteria of this unit and include evidence that the candidate:

locates and applies relevant documentation, policies and procedures

demonstrates completion of cutting, welding and bending materials that safely, effectively and efficiently meets all of the required outcomes on more than one (1) occasion including:

identifying and matching cutting equipment with job task

setting up oxyacetylene, electric welding and bending equipment in correct sequence

testing the equipment

accurately mark and secure or clamp material ready for bending and cutting

lighting torch correctly and safely

adjusting setting of flame for cutting

controlling the heat of the torch to suit the materials being bent

adopting correct cutting position during cutting to set out mark

welding and cutting materials cleanly

cleaning and visually inspecting the welds for defects

bending materials to job task requirements

shutting down the torch and gas supply in sequence

The candidate must demonstrate knowledge of cutting, welding and bending materials through:

identifying manual metal arc welding, oxyacetylene and LPG heating and cutting equipment types, characteristics, uses and limitations

relevant welding, bending and cutting techniques

relevant equipment and machinery used in welding, bending and cutting materials

using construction and steel fixing terminology

types and properties of steel fixing materials

processes for the calculation of material requirements
